KAMINSKY -- read once and referred to the Committee on Codes AN ACT to amend the penal law, in relation to sex trafficking of persons less than eighteen years old The People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em- bly, do enact as follows: 1 Section 1. Paragraph (h) of subdivision 5 of section 230.34 of the 2 penal law, as added by chapter 74 of the laws of 2007, is amended and a 3 new subdivision 6 is added to read as follows: 4 (h) perform any other act which would not in itself materially benefit 5 the actor but which is calculated to harm the person who is patronized 6 materially with respect to his or her health, safety, or immigration 7 status[.]; or 8 6. knowingly advancing prostitution of a person less than eighteen 9 years old. 10 § 2. This act shall take effect on the ninetieth day after it shall 11 have become a law. EXPLANATION--Matter in italics (underscored) is new; matter in brackets [] is old law to be omitted. LBD14030-01-6
